AMD通用型云服务器(如阿里云的g8a、腾讯云的S5、华为云的s7等基于AMD EPYC处理器的通用型实例)整体上适合部署Web服务和中等负载的数据库,但对高并发应用需结合具体场景谨慎评估,并非“开箱即用”的最优选择。以下是详细分析:
✅ 适合部署:Web服务(推荐)
- AMD EPYC处理器通常具备高核心数、大内存带宽和优秀多线程性能(如EPYC 9004系列支持128核/256线程),非常适合处理大量轻量级HTTP请求(如Nginx、Apache、Node.js、Java Spring Boot等)。
- 性价比优势明显:同等vCPU/内存配置下,AMD通用型实例价格通常比同代Intel实例低15%–30%,适合流量中等、注重成本效益的Web集群(如企业官网、CMS、API网关、微服务前端)。
- 支持主流虚拟化与容器运行时(KVM、Docker/K8s),生态兼容性良好。
✅ 可部署:中等规模数据库(需调优)
- 适用于MySQL、PostgreSQL等OLTP场景(如中小电商后台、SaaS租户库),尤其当工作负载偏重读多写少、连接数适中(<2000)、数据量在TB级以内时表现稳定。
- ⚠️ 注意事项:
- AMD平台在极低延迟敏感场景(如X_X高频交易)或部分NUMA感知不佳的数据库版本中,可能因内存延迟略高于高端Intel(如Xeon Platinum)而影响极限QPS;
- 建议启用
numactl绑定、优化内核参数(如vm.swappiness=1)、使用SSD云盘+合理IOPS配置,并优先选用较新内核(≥5.10)以获得更好的AMD调度支持。
❌ 高并发应用需分场景判断(不直接推荐“通用型”)
- ❌ 纯CPU密集型高并发(如实时音视频转码、风控计算):通用型实例的CPU主频通常中等(如EPYC 9B14基础频率2.8GHz),不如专用计算型(c系列)或高主频Intel实例(如Intel c7i);建议选AMD计算型(如c8a)或高主频机型。
- ❌ 超高连接数/超低延迟网络应用(如百万级长连接IM、实时游戏服):通用型网络性能受限于共享带宽和底层虚拟化开销;应优先考虑增强网络能力的实例(如阿里云g8ae/g9e、支持SR-IOV或弹性RDMA)。
- ✅ 可支撑的“高并发”场景:若指海量HTTP API并发(如10万+ QPS的RESTful服务),配合负载均衡+自动伸缩,AMD通用型凭借高vCPU密度仍具优势——此时瓶颈常在应用层/数据库/网络,而非CPU本身。
📌 关键建议:
- 优先看 workload 特征,而非厂商标签:用
stress-ng+sysbench实测你的实际应用(如模拟真实请求压测),比理论参数更可靠。 - 关注配套资源:AMD实例的性价比发挥依赖于——高速云盘(ESSD AutoPL)、足够内存(避免swap)、优化的OS镜像(如Alibaba Cloud Linux 3 / Ubuntu 22.04 LTS)。
- 规避已知兼容性问题:极少数老旧中间件(如某些Oracle旧版本、特定加密库)可能存在AMD微码兼容性问题,上线前务必验证。
✅ 总结一句话:
AMD通用型 = Web服务“性价比首选”,中等数据库“务实之选”,高并发应用“需精准匹配场景+针对性调优”,而非万能解药。
如需进一步选型建议,欢迎提供您的具体应用类型(如“日活50万用户的Spring Boot电商API”)、并发目标、数据规模和SLA要求,我可以帮您做针对性配置推荐。
云知识CLOUD